18 July 2007
Webb Bridge
South Fork Holston River
Sullivan County, TN

A new Cliff Swallow colony has been found under the Webb Bridge on the South 
Fork Holston River.  It
appears to have ~ 300 nest or so.  I bird the area frequently but this is the 
first time I recall having
seen the swallows there.  I am not aware of anyone else having posted their 
presence. This area is 
also known as Riverside and is on Old Weaver Pike.

  

On 20 Apr 2007 Cliff Swallows (~ 300 birds) were swirling about the bridge over 
the river at the traditional nesting 
colony at  Emmet Bridge where the highway crosses just below the downstream tip 
of Osceola Island near the 
Weir Dam which if 4.5 river miles upstream from the new colony which is located 
at river mile 39.5.
